The Core Mechanics of Virtual Ice Fishing
At the heart of any good ice fishing game app lies a commitment to recreating the fundamental elements of the real sport. Players typically begin by selecting a location, often based on real-world lakes and rivers known for their ice fishing potential. From there, it’s a matter of drilling a hole – sometimes a mini-game in itself – and preparing the fishing line. The selection of bait is crucial, as different species respond to different offerings.
Once the line is in the water, the waiting game begins. This is where the simulation aspect comes into play, with factors like water temperature, weather patterns, and even time of day influencing the bite. Successfully landing a fish often requires skillful reflexes and an understanding of the fish’s behavior – just like the real thing.

Understanding Fish AI and Behavior Patterns
The realism of an ice fishing game app hinges heavily on its fish AI. Good simulations don’t simply present fish as random targets. Instead, they model behaviors based on factors such as species, depth, water temperature, light levels, and the type of bait used. Understanding these patterns is crucial for success. For example, some species might be more active during certain times of the day, or prefer specific types of structure. The most realistic games require careful observation and experimentation to unlock the secrets of each fishing spot.
Advanced simulations may also incorporate factors like water currents, oxygen levels, and even the presence of other fish to create a complex and dynamic ecosystem. This heightened level of detail demands a more strategic approach to fishing. Players must consider all relevant variables when selecting a location and choosing their bait.
Strategic Location Selection and Depth Management
In the real world, finding a promising ice fishing spot involves analyzing the lake or riverbed for structure, identifying areas where fish are likely to congregate, and considering the prevailing weather conditions. The best ice fishing game apps translate these considerations into the digital realm. Players often have access to detailed maps with sonar-like views of the underwater terrain. Based on these maps, they can identify promising areas and drill their holes accordingly.
Managing the depth of the fishing line is another critical skill. Different species and different times of day may require adjusting the depth to reach the fish, knowing when fish are deep or shallow can be the difference between catching something or not. Experimentation and a keen understanding of fish behavior are key to optimizing fishing success. Realistic simulations may even factor in the effects of ice thickness on line sensitivity.
